
Greg Garrett, owner of Applied Materials Technology in Chandler, Ariz. and long-time National Plasterers Council technical advisor, has taken a part-time staff position with the industry organization. He now will serve as director of technical services. In his new role, Garrett will handle technical inquiries from professionals and consumers, in addition to contributing more to the organization's education and certification programs, and its original research.
"Through creation of this position, the NPC has enhanced its focus in the areas of technical information development, pursuit of new research opportunities and membership support functions," said NPC Chairman Dave Schilli in a press release.
Garrett long has been a key instructor with NPC, among other things leading many of its start-up certification courses, and has participated in or led most research efforts, such as the current evaporation study being performed in conjunction with several other industry organizations.
"This means NPC is doing a better job of helping our members and being better help with consumers who have questions and are looking for a legitimate authority to call and question about something in their pools," Garrett said.
Garrett serves in this new role in addition to continuing with his own business.
